My 2018 CX5 just hit 50,000 miles recently and I smelled something burning and saw smoke coming from the hood while I was stopped for a school bus. I immediately stopped driving due to fire concerns. The vehicle has a cracked cylinder which is a known issue for this vehicle. Mazda has no plans to correct this issue other than issuing a technical bulletin. I feel that Mazda should repair this at th
... eir cost because it is a defect and the vehicle only has 50,000 miles. Instead I have to pay nearly $5,000. This is hard to believe! Transcript from dealer: The technician reported an oil leak from the cylinder head, specifically indicating a crack in the number four lifter valley that is causing fluid to leak down the engine block. This issue is recognized as a known problem, and the technician will check if it is covered under warranty. Repairing the cylinder head will require significant labor, including dropping the engine, and will take some time to complete. Services being performed: - Oil change. - Inspection for oil leak issue. Recommendations: - Replacement of the cylinder head due to the identified oil leak. Multi Point Inspection $4870.22Read more

I own a 2012 Volkswagen Passat [VIN [XXX] ] with approximately 1315xx miles. On December 17, 2025, I took the car to Rockwall County Volkswagen for three recalls. The car was running and was driven 9.5 miles to the dealership under its own power. I left the engine running when I left the it with the service advisor. When I returned to retrieve the car the following day, the service advisor inform
... ed me the car would not start. Their explanation shifted within the same conversation — first that someone had shut it off and it would not crank, then that it would crank but would not start. They claimed they had to pushed it into the service bay, replaced the airbag, and "code the computer for the clock-spring." The dealer refused to repair the no-start condition that occurred in their custody. I towed the car home at my own expense - $161. I performed my own diagnostic work using VW scan tools. The vehicle exhibited a textbook immobilizer or component protection rejection pattern: it would crank, start briefly for 1–2 seconds, then shut off, with three instrument cluster chimes and the coolant fan activating. The scan tool could not communicate with all vehicle modules, consistent with a failed module programming. After contacting the dealer's service manager, I towed the car back to the dealership [$64]. The dealer kept it from December 2025 through April 7, 2026 — approximately four months. During this time, they replaced the battery (charging me) and replaced the engine control module with a used unit they sourced and reprogrammed (charging me a total of $804.38). On April 7, 2026, I drove the car home. The vehicle was driven less than 35 miles after pickup before failing again. On April 27, 2026, my daughter — who had just undergone a serious medical procedure — was driving the car home and was stranded on the side of the road in 90+ degree Texas heat when the car suddenly stopped running with no warning or indication of impending failure. 2021 BMW X5 xDrive45e PHEV, built October 2020 by BMW AG (Germany). In-service Oct 28, 2021. Vehicle intermittently shows "Drivetrain Malfunction — you can continue driving" warning. DME scan reveals 5 fault codes, all for the conventional 12V pinion starter: 21A50A — Pinion starter: timeout occurred several times in succession 21A511 — Pinion starter: timeout 21611A — Pinion starter:
... starting torque could not be built up; high counter torque and/or undervoltage 216119 — Pinion starter: line break in starter control (KL50/KL30) 216115 — Pinion starter: attempt to start with blocked starter detected 21A50A and 216115 are protected memory codes that cannot be cleared by standard OBD-II tools. The main 12V AGM battery was replaced and registered; codes continue to recur. This signature matches the B58 pinion starter defect addressed in NHTSA Recall 24V-576 (Aug 2024) and 25V644 (Nov 2025, physical starter replacement). The vehicle's German manufacture date falls inside the production windows of KBA recalls 15630R, 15632R, and 15633R — all covering X5 G05 for short-circuit and fire risk from starter relay corrosion or inadequate mounting. BMW AG has issued an ADAC advisory not to leave affected vehicles running unattended after starting. BMW NA Customer Relations was contacted. Initial verbal response: U.S. recalls don't apply because the xDrive45e PHEV uses a different starter than non-hybrid B58 vehicles. However, codes 216115 and 216119 only exist on vehicles equipped with a conventional pinion starter — confirming this vehicle has the same component. The subsequent written denial pivoted to warranty expiration without addressing the technical or recall-scope questions. Filing so the field record reflects this defect signature for future U.S. recall scope expansion analysis.Read more
